Nina goes to the neighborhood store to buy 14 rolls of toilet paper. If she spent $20.02 in all for her purchase, how much does one roll of toilet paper cost?

Answer:

Each roll is $1.43.

Step-by-step explanation:

20.02 ÷ 14 = 1.43.

1.43 × 14 = 20.02.
